Grunt (программное обеспечение)

Grunt  (англ.)менеджер задач для автоматического выполнения рутинных операций (например, минификация, тестирование, объединение файлов), написанный на языке программирования JavaScript. Программное обеспечение использует командную строку для запуска задач[3], определённых в файле Gruntfile. Распространяется через менеджер пакетов NPM под лицензией MIT.

Grunt
Тип система сборки[вд] и библиотека JavaScript
Автор Бен Алман
Написана на Node.js
Операционные системы Linux, OS X, Windows
Первый выпуск 11 января 2012
Последняя версия
Репозиторий github.com/gruntjs/grunt
Состояние активное
Лицензия MIT
Сайт gruntjs.com

Создан Беном Алманом для Node.js в 2012 году.

На 2017 год насчитывается более 6 200 плагинов[4].

Программное обеспечение используется в Adobe Systems, jQuery, Twitter, Mozilla, Bootstrap, Cloudant, Opera, WordPress, Walmart и Microsoft[5].

Развитием Grunt стал менеджер Gulp.

Примечания

править
  1. Release 1.6.1 — 2023.
  2. npmjs
  3. Introducing Grunt. Дата обращения: 9 марта 2017. Архивировано 12 марта 2017 года.
  4. Packages with keyword ‘gruntplugin’
  5. Who uses Grunt. Дата обращения: 9 марта 2017. Архивировано 7 апреля 2017 года.

Литература

править
  • Cryer, James. Pro Grunt.js. — 2015. — ISBN 978-1-4842-0013-1.
  • Pillora, Jamie. Getting Started with Grunt: The JavaScript Task Runner. — 2014. — ISBN 978-1-78398-062-8.
  • Grunt для тех, кто считает штуки вроде него странными и сложными

Ссылки

править